What is iMessage Number Filtering? Why Do Overseas Marketers Need It?

iMessage number filtering, simply put, is batch-checking a list of phone numbers to determine whether each number has activated Apple’s iMessage service. It differs from regular SMS verification (echo SMS): iMessage is based on the Apple Push Notification service (APNs) channel and can only verify whether the number is associated with an iMessage account; it cannot detect whether an SMS will be delivered.

In overseas marketing, the necessity of iMessage number filtering is reflected in three aspects:

  • Precise Reach : Only numbers with iMessage activated can receive iMessage messages. If you blindly send to all numbers, those without iMessage will be downgraded to regular SMS, resulting in a poor experience and wasted costs (SMS costs abroad are much higher than iMessage channel costs).
  • Prevent Account Bans : Apple has clear limitations on iMessage bulk sending. Sending to a large number of invalid numbers triggers anti-spam policies, leading to Apple ID restrictions. Filtering to send only to valid numbers significantly reduces the risk of account bans.
  • Cost Optimization : In most overseas teams’ number pools, iOS users are not the majority. Using iMessage detection to pre-filter can avoid paying unnecessary message fees for Android numbers or virtual operator numbers.

Therefore, iMessage number filtering has become a standard step in iOS message screening for B2B SaaS overseas teams, cross-border e-commerce, and independent site promotion teams. Detailed Explanation of iMessage Number Filtering Detection Capabilities

Principles and Result Classification of iMessage Activation Detection

The essence of iMessage number filtering is verification based on the Apple Push Notification service (APNs). The system initiates an iMessage registration query to the target number and returns whether the number is registered as an iMessage user on Apple’s servers. The results fall into two categories:

  • Activated: The number is bound to an iMessage account and can receive iMessage messages.
  • Not Activated / Invalid: The number is not registered for iMessage, has an incorrect format, or belongs to a non-Apple device carrier.

Note: Detection Accuracy

Due to fluctuations in Apple server responses, carrier restrictions, virtual numbers, etc., a very small number of results may be “uncertain” or temporarily abnormal. It is recommended to perform a second verification on high-value numbers or combine data from other platforms for comprehensive judgment. Technically, iMessage number filtering only verifies activation status and does not provide activity levels, device model, or other information.

Common Misconceptions and Precautions of iMessage Number Filtering

Misconception 1: Thinking iMessage Filtering Provides Activity Data

iMessage filtering only verifies activation status. It does not provide user activity levels, online duration, device model, etc. If you need to determine whether a user has been active recently (e.g., last 30 days), use platforms like Telegram that support activity detection.

Misconception 2: Believing Detection Is 100% Accurate

Due to Apple server limitations, carrier differences, virtual operators (e.g., Google Voice), a very small portion of numbers may return “uncertain” or erroneous results. It is recommended not to rely solely on a single detection as the only decision basis, especially for high-value numbers where secondary verification should be considered.

Misconception 3: Ignoring Compliance of Number Sources

iMessage marketing must comply with local data privacy regulations (e.g., GDPR, CCPA). The number pool used must have a legitimate source to avoid account bans or legal risks from purchasing black/grey market data.

Practical Recommendations

  • Test Small Batches Before Scaling : When first using iMessage number filtering, submit a test of 1,000–5,000 numbers to observe result distribution and speed before processing large batches.
  • Validate Number Format : Ensure numbers include international dialing codes (e.g., +86, +1) and no spaces or special characters before importing.
  • Monitor Platform Policies : Apple has clear restrictions on iMessage marketing. Continuous high-volume sending may result in Apple ID restrictions. Filtering + controlling sending frequency is key to healthy operation.

Q: Can iMessage number filtering detect currently active users?
A: No. iMessage filtering only verifies whether the number has activated iMessage service; it cannot determine if the user is actively using it. If you need activity data, consider combining with Telegram activity detection.

Q: Are all “iMessage activated” numbers necessarily Apple devices?
A: Generally yes. Only Apple devices can register iMessage accounts. However, in rare cases, numbers logged into iMessage via Mac or iPad may also be identified as activated, so the final target device depends on actual usage.
